THE COVER LETTER - about

 
The Cover Letter is not intended as a self-contained document – it will always be accompanied by a Resume.



It should not be longer than one page.
Use the following information to personalize the cover letter:
- the reply to an advertisement
-  a certain publication;
- a company that you identified during your research and you would like to work for;
- reading an article regarding the company and its management;
- the presentation of that company made by one of its employees(Surname, Name).

The more personal the cover letter is the better. ___________________

    * On one of the upper corners of the page (the left corner is recommended) write a paragraph containing the personal information
which should include the surname, the name, the address and phone number.
Also, write the date. Unlike the Resume, the Cover Letter should include the date.         * Under the personal information paragraph (leave a blank line between paragraphs) write the company information,
respectively the name and address of the company.
    * If you know the name of the company’s manager or human resources manager, it is recommended that you address him/her the letter,
using the words “To the attention of the .... Manager (human resources manager)”, right under the company paragraph.     * If you do not know the name of these persons you can use “To the attention of Human Resources Department…” Leave a few blank lines and then write “Dear Mr.(Mrs.)...” starting on the left side.
 
 

Writing the content (which usually comprises 4 paragraphs):   
 1 - how you learned about the position;
2 - the job of your dreams, why you want that job and convince them that this “why” will be a mutual benefit;  
3  - review your skills, personal competences and your experience in the field which are relevant and which entitle you to aspire to that position, mentioning that you attached a resume to the cover letter;
4 - show your availability to meet for an interview in order to provide more details.
Sign by hand on the same side where you wrote the address and use in conclusion, for example: “Sincerely,....”.
